Choose to retire to one of the ‘Best Places To Live’

Specialist developer, Beechcroft, takes care to select the very best locations for its retirement communities – and the lifestyle publication, ‘Muddy Stilettos’ has just proved that this is certainly the case. A number of locations chosen by Beechcroft top the lists of the ‘Best Places to Live in 2023’ as voted for by the readers of ‘Muddy Stilettos.’

Wallingford, selected as the top location to live in Oxfordshire, is described as ‘a characterful riverside town with a burgeoning foodie scene, indie shopping and the market town essential – Waitrose.’  

Wallingford is also considered to have shopping that’s ‘quirky and independent-focused,’ a restaurant scene ‘buzzing with gastro options galore’ and a lively cultural scene.  Beechcroft’s previous Wallingford developments proved popular and the company will be launching a new retirement community of just 23 two-bedroom apartments in early 2024.  Other locations voted into the top 10 ‘Best Places to Live’ in Oxfordshire include Burford, home to Beechcroft’s Cotswold Gate and Watlington, the location of the company’s Castle Gardens.

Tunbridge Wells appears in third place on the ‘Best Places To Live In Kent’ listings.

Muddy Stilettos heralded the town’s ‘growing reputation as a foodie destination with stunning scenery all around and decent train links to London.’ 

Following the success of its previous development in Tunbridge Wells, Beechcroft is turning its attention to Montier Place, a collection of 40 one and two-bedroom apartments overlooking Tunbridge Wells Common, scheduled for launch in early 2024.

Windsor, ‘a world-famous address with oodles of history and the most multi-millionaires outside of London,’ appears in second place on the list of the Best Places to Live In Berkshire

You don’t need to be a multi-millionaire to own a home at Pinewood Place, Beechcroft’s gated retirement development of 29 new homes, located just off Hatch Lane within easy reach of Windsor’s town centre. 

Those who are living in Windsor or have close connections with the town are able to take advantage of discounted market sale apartments at Bramley House, Pinewood Place, with prices starting from just £350,000.

Surrey has an abundance of beautiful, vibrant towns and villages – one of which is Reigate which took the number 4 spot in the Best Places to Live in Surrey.  

The publication describes Reigate as a  “..thriving and affluent market town with a high street chock full of independent shops and restaurants and, still an easy commute to the capital.’

Reigate has also been chosen as one of the Best Places to Live in 2023 by ‘The Times.’  Beechcroft’s Fonthill Place, located on Reigate Road, is a collection of new and converted two and three-bedroom apartments, set within mature, landscaped, walled gardens within easy reach of the town centre.

 

Another of Beechcroft’s retirement developments located in a one of the top places to live is Redclyffe Place in Harpenden – a town which takes fifth place in the list of Best Places to Live in Hertfordshire.

Harpenden, according to the magazine, is a ‘lovely town built for those who enjoy the finer things in life… packed with great pubs, restaurants and independent shops.”  

At Redclyffe Place, retirement home buyers will find just 9 new homes including 4 three-bedroom houses and 5 one, two and three-bedroom apartments with private terraces, gardens or balconies.  Three of the new homes have been created within a listed property and six are newly constructed homes designed to complement the period property.
